People living in cities are exposed to a greater extent, as a consequence
of increased industrialization and demands for energy
and motor vehicles. Occupational exposure is also an
important factor that should be taken into consideration. During
the last decade, health effects of air pollution are studied
more in developed countries, while more and better environmental
monitoring data are required in order to setup threshold
levels. In addition efforts should be intensified by taking the
appropriate measures, in order to reduce the possibility of human
pollutant exposure.
